SUMOylation- and GAR1-Dependent Regulation of Dyskerin Nuclear and Subnuclear Localization
The nuclear and subnuclear compartmentalization of the telomerase-associated protein and H/ACA ribonucleoprotein component dyskerin is an important although incompletely understood aspect of H/ACA ribonucleoprotein function.
